For our operation in Brazil, we are looking for a Line Manager (at least 3 or 4 years of experience) and, if possible, leading other countries in the Americas (Canada).

A Manager within R&A provides leadership and direction to Associates, Consultants and Senior Consultants, actively managing employee performance and development.

A Manager acts as a role model and provides or organizes coaching/mentoring and feedback to direct reports.

Provides a broad range of consulting services and works within broad project guidelines to identify, refine, and address client issues and to achieve project objectives.
